Persea americana Mill., avocado, is a popular traditional fruit food that is consumed during food scarcity in Southwestern Nigeria. The plant of P. americana have several therapeutic effects including analgesic, anti-inflammatory and hypotensive effects. The essential oil obtained by hydrodistillation from the leaf of the plant was analyzed by gas chromatography (GC) and g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C-MS).β-Caryophyllene (43.9%) and valencene (16.0%) are the most abundant compounds in the oil. Other quantitatively significant constituents are germacrene D (5.9%), α-humulene (5.0%) and δ-cadinene (4.8%)
